iFresh Announces Fiscal Second Quarter 2020 Financial Results

NEW YORK, Nov. 24, 2020 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- iFresh, Inc. (“iFresh” or the “Company”) (Nasdaq: IFMK), a leading Asian American grocery supermarket chain and online grocer, announced the financial results for its fiscal second quarter ended September 30, 2020.

For the second quarter 2020, the Company achieved total net sales of $24.2 million and gross profit of $4.8 million, a slight increase from the same quarter of 2019. The adjusted loss before income tax, depreciation and amortization was $2.4 million, resulting from the acquisition of Jiuxiang Blue Sky Technology (Beijing) Co., Ltd. (“Jiuxiang”) which had a net loss of $2.2 million. Founded in 2019, Jiuxiang is an emerging e-commerce enterprise in China and still in the early-growth stage. A key part of business strategy of Jiuxiang is to transform the supply chain financial service capabilities into a revenue growth driver to achieve customer expansion in the market.

As of September 30, 2020, the Company had cash and cash equivalents of $7.8 million and a total accounts receivable of $4.3 million.

About iFresh, Inc.

iFresh Inc. (Nasdaq: IFMK), headquartered in Long Island City, New York, is a leading Asian American grocery supermarket chain and online grocer on the east coast of U.S. With nine retail supermarkets along the US eastern seaboard (with additional stores in Glen Cove, Miami and Connecticut opening soon), and one in-house wholesale business strategically located in cities with a highly concentrated Asian population, iFresh aims to satisfy the increasing demands of Asian Americans (whose purchasing power has been growing rapidly) for fresh and culturally unique produce, seafood and other groceries that are not found in mainstream supermarkets. With an in-house proprietary delivery network, online sales channel and strong relations with farms that produce Chinese specialty vegetables and fruits, iFresh is able to offer fresh, high-quality specialty produce at competitive prices to a growing base of customers.
